which of the following is least likely to change the gene pool of a population of chipmunks?\na pesticide poisons and kills a large number of chipmunks.\na group of chipmunks moves to a new habitat.\na number of chipmunks die due to old age.\na genetic mutation causes some of the chipmunks to have larger eyes.
Answer
Brief Explanations:
A gene pool is the set of all genes in a population. Deaths due to old - age are a normal part of life - cycle and are not likely to significantly alter the frequencies of alleles in the gene pool compared to other factors. Pesticide poisoning can cause non - random death and remove certain genotypes from the population. Migration to a new habitat can introduce or remove alleles through gene flow. Genetic mutations introduce new alleles into the gene pool.
Answer:
A number of chipmunks die due to old age.
